Alloy Specifications, Chemistries, and Technical Data

COPPER NICKEL C96400
Aliases
CDA NUMBER C96400
Common Name 70:30 Copper Nickel
Alias 70:30
Alias Cooper Nickel
Alias C964
Alias 964
Nearest Applicable Casting Standards
ASTM (B Series) B369, B30
Federal (QQ-C- Series) 390
Military (Mil-C- Series) 20159
Specification Composition
Minimum Maximum
Lead (Pb) 0.01
Iron (Fe) 0.25 1.5
Nickel (Ni) 28 32
Sulphur (S) 0.02
Phosphorous (P) 0.02
Carbon (C) 0.15
Manganese (Mn) 1.5
Silicon (Si) 0.5
Niobium (Nb) 0.5 1.5
Copper + Sum of Named Elements 99.5
Specification Properties
(Heat Treat 'F' Denotes As Cast) Heat Treat State Minimum
Tensile Strength (ksi) F 60
Yield Strength (.5% extension under load) (ksi) F 32
Elongation (2 inch gauge length) (%) F 20
Typical Properties
Heat Treat State Typical
Modulus of Elasticity (ksi) 21000
Hardness (Brinell) (HB @ 3000kg) 140
Machinability (% of free cutting brass) 20
Fatigue Strength (10^8 cycles) (ksi) 18
Impact Strength (Charpy) (ft-lb) 78
Melting Range (Liquidus-Solidus)(F) 2140-2260
Coefficient of Thermal Expansion (per F @ 68-400F) 0.0000090
Thermal Conductivity (Btu/sq.ft/ft./hr/F @ 68F) 17
Specific Heat (Btu/lb/F @ 68F) 0.09
Electrical Conductivity (% IACS @ 68F) 5
Density (lb/cu.in. @ 68F) 0.323
Pouring Temperature (Light Castings) (F) 2500-2650
Pouring Temperature (Heavy Castings) (F) 2350-2500
Patternmakers Shrinkage (in/ft) 7/32
Drossing Medium
Gassing High
Fluidity High
Shrinkage High
Casting Yield Low
Comments
Wear Resistance: Very good.
Applications
Discharge Casing
Elbows
Flanges
Gland Follower
Gland Followers
Impeller
Mounting Bracket
Packing Gland
Pump Bodies
Suction Casing
Used For Seawater Corrosion
Valves

Use Good Design Principles

1. St. Paul Foundry is providing this information on metal characteristics for informational purposes only. Before making a final decision on alloy selection consider the following and all other appropriate design and specification principles. Please note that this is not an exhaustive list.

2. Consult the appropriate specification from an accredited specifying body (ASTM, SAE, Federal or Military) to determine current minimum values of this alloy.

3. Use appropriate design safety factors.

4. Use Failure Modes and Effects Analysis to help identify possible weaknesses in designs and specifications.

5. Use computerized stress analysis tools.

6. Use appropriate certification requirements for your casting suppliers. These may include test bars, chemical certifications, radiography, dye penetrant or other non-destructive testing methods.

7. Test your design to failure in a controlled environment. Then test it to failure in a simulation of its end use.
